Why it is much better than Cast Resin Dry-type Transformer ?

Enhanced Safety There are no liquids to spill, explode or burn, and NOMEX does not support combustion in air. In the case of a building fire, NOMEX products do not produce significant amounts of toxic smoke or dangerous particles. (For this reason, among others, NOMEX is used extensively in honeycomb structures for aircraft interiors).

Low Transmission Losses Since dry type transformers insulated with NOMEX can be located close to their loads - inside factories, schools, hospitals and apartments - low-voltage lines can be shortened.

Reduced Cost, Size and Weight 150 C-rise units insulated with NOMEX require less conductor and core steel, resulting in lower initial cost. This reduced size and weight contributes to ease of installation, especially since no vaults or catch basins are required. Smaller cores also mean lower no-load losses.

Increased Reserve Capacity If transformers are to be operated continuously at or near their rated loads, efficiency is of prime importance. In this case, one could select 80 C-rise units insulated with NOMEX, allowing these units to operate continuously at 133 percent of rated load (if needed, for example, due to unplanned expansions) at a much lower cost (in increased load loss) than that associated with adding an additional transformer.

Improved Reliability Surveys published by IEEE show failure rates of modern open ventilated dry type transformers equivalent to conventional liquid-filled units in the same power and voltage classes. Repair time for dry type units is also considerably shorter.

Resistance to Humidity Since the properties of densified NOMEX papers and pressboards are insensitive to moisture, open ventilated transformers insulated with NOMEXR perform satisfactorily in the most humid environments. This allows the placement of OVDT units in many locations not considered in the past.

Friendly to the Environment At the end of their useful life, VDT units can easily be dismantled, and the copper (or aluminum) conductors recovered, along with the steel core.
